The Harbour Column Dining Table embodies balance, visually and functionally. Available with a round or rectangular top and a choice of a star or round base, it offers a sculptural presence that complements a variety of interiors, from residential dining rooms to restaurants, meeting areas and collaborative workspaces. With its distinctive column and choice of five tabletop finishes, it’s adaptable in both shape and style.

Black Steel
Powder coating provides a robust, durable and uniform finish on metal surfaces. More resistant to scratching, fading and general wear and tear than traditional liquid paint, it also acts as a protective barrier, reducing the risk of corrosion. Gloss 10 provides a low sheen.

Black Stained Oak
Please note: as each sample is crafted from natural wood, variations in colour and grain are to be expected.
Black-stained oak veneer with PU lacquer is constructed with a core material covered by a thin layer of oak veneer, which has undergone a staining process, resulting in a dark surface that alters the natural color of the wood. The veins of the wood are subtly visible through the polyurethane lacquer, adding a nuanced and textured dimension to the smooth and glossy finish of the surface.

Kunis Breccia
An artistic blend of different stones, Kunis Breccia is defined by characteristic veins and mineral fragments in warm hues. The stone is treated with a sealant to provide the optimal compromise between a natural finish and functionality.

Linoleum Charcoal
Linoleum is a sustainable and durable natural material that is soft to the touch. Its antimicrobial properties, resilience to moisture and scratches and non-toxic composition make it ideal as a tabletop. Soft and warm to the touch, it enhances the overall look and feel of surfaces.

Estremoz Marble
Estremoz marble is a high-quality, Portuguese marble defined by its fine grain and red-tinged cream base with varying patterns and veining that spans pink, cream and white to grey or black. The marble is treated with a sealant to provide the optimal compromise between a natural finish and functionality.

MEET THE DESIGNER
Norm Architects
Founded in Copenhagen in 2008 by Jonas Bjerre-Poulsen and Kasper Rønn, Norm Architects specialises in residential architecture, commercial interiors, industrial design, photography and art direction. The name reflects the studio’s emphasis on drawing inspiration from norms and traditions in architecture and design—particularly the Scandinavian design ideology of timeless aesthetics and natural materials and Modernist ideas of restraint and refinement. Guided by these principles, Norm Architects creates designs that unite materials and craftsmanship while embodying beauty, history and, most importantly, timeless simplicity—with nothing more to add or subtract. A longstanding collaborator with Audo, Norm Architects helps to drive the evolution of the brand and its products with the same fundamental ethos that guides its own creative direction: a simplicity that carries bigger ideas.
